Abstract
Micellar assemblies orient at graphite surfaces in the same way as the channels in mesoporous silica films. Evidence to suggest that the str uctural organization of the surfactant surface phase extends far beyon d the hemicylindrical micellar monolayer located at the water-graphite interface is presented and details of the proposed assembly process g iven. An understanding of the origin of the coalignment between silica channels and graphite surface structures is the goal of this investig ation, important for the design of mesoporous films and membranes with predetermined architectures.
